
VISALIA, Calif. (Jan. 30, 2023) – At least five people suffered injuries following two collisions involving a suspected DUI driver on Road 108 in Visalia.
The collisions occurred about 6 p.m. on Sunday, Jan. 29th on Road 108 near Avenue 264, according to the California Highway Patrol.
Jeffrey Meek, 35, of Visalia, was traveling at high speed northbound on Road 108 and allegedly caused two collisions with three other motorists, according to YourCentralValley.com.
The first occurred near Avenue 264 when the Visalia man reportedly sideswiped a Toyota RAV 4 SUV traveling ahead of him in the same direction and fled the scene. The woman driving the RAV4 and her 3-month-old passenger were both taken to a hospital with minor injuries.
Next, the suspect continued driving north on Road 108 until he crashed into the drivers of a Toyota Camry sedan and a Honda Civic.
A pregnant woman riding as a passenger in the Toyota suffered minor injuries and reported having contractions. She was taken to a hospital for treatment. Also, the drivers of the Toyota and Honda were taken to the hospital with minor to major injuries.
Meanwhile, authorities reported that Jeffrey Meek also suffered minor injuries and got treated at the hospital before being booked at Tulare County Pre-Trial Facility on suspicion of driving under the influence of alcohol and or drugs.
The crash remains under investigation.
